Flashes Field Hockey Travels to Ohio
4/15/2021 1:00:00 PM | Field Hockey
The Kent State field hockey team (7-3, 5-3 MAC) travels to Athens, Ohio to battle against Ohio University on Friday, April 16 and Saturday, April 17 at Pruitt Field. Friday's game will start at 3 p.m. and Saturday's game is scheduled to begin at 3:30 p.m.
The Golden Flashes won both of their games last weekend against Ball State University. They have now beaten the Cardinals the last ten times the two teams have met. They look to continue their streak against Ohio as well, a team they have also beaten the past eight times.
SCOUTING OHIO
The Bobcats finished 2019 with an 8-8 overall record and are 3-7 this Spring. Five of their seven losses this year have been decided by only one goal. Freshman goalkeeper Macy Lotze received Defensive Player of the Week honors last week allowing no goals while making nine saves. Ohio defeated Longwood 3-1 their last time out.
THE SERIES
Last season, the Golden Flashes beat the Bobcats 5-1 at Murphy-Mellis Field. Kent State now holds a 51-26-2 all-time series advantage over Ohio.
